Course structure

• Introduction to Environmental Health and Cultural Perspectives
• Cultural Dimensions of Environmental Risk and Vulnerability
• Traditional Ecological Knowledge and Sustainable Practices
• Global Environmental Policies and Cultural Implications
• Climate Change, Health, and Cultural Adaptation Strategies
• Environmental Justice and Equity Across Cultures
• Indigenous Perspectives on Land, Water, and Resource Management
• Cross-Cultural Communication in Environmental Health Advocacy
• Case Studies in Cultural Responses to Environmental Challenges
• Future Directions: Integrating Cultural Insights into Environmental Health Solutions

Role Description
Environmental Health Specialist Work with communities to address environmental health issues, integrating cultural perspectives to develop sustainable solutions.
Sustainability Consultant Advise organizations on sustainable practices, ensuring cultural sensitivity and environmental health alignment.
Public Health Advocate Promote policies and programs that improve environmental health while respecting cultural diversity and traditions.
Cultural Resource Manager Manage natural and cultural resources, balancing environmental health goals with cultural preservation.
Community Development Officer Collaborate with local communities to implement environmental health initiatives that align with cultural values.
Environmental Educator Develop and deliver educational programs on environmental health, incorporating cultural perspectives to engage diverse audiences.
Global Health Researcher Conduct research on the intersection of culture and environmental health, contributing to global health policies and practices.
